A PEMBROKE man appeared in court to answer multiple charges of common assault and one of theft.
Mark Abraham, of The Green, appearing before Haverfordwest Magistrates Court on Tuesday, January 6, pleaded guilty to all five charges.
All offences took place on December 8, 2025 at Pembroke, where the 51-year-old assaulted three males and one female. He also admitted stealing groceries, to the value of £46.16, from Co-op Stores Pembroke.
The defendant was remanded on bail, pending the next hearing for sentencing at magistrates’ court at 10am on January 27, 2026. Bail conditions include a ban on entering Pembroke Co-op and its vicinity of Gooses Lane. They also prohibit him from having any contact with named victims of the assaults.
